- NVIDIA GPUs excel with top-tier performance, especially in ray tracing and AI with DLSS. They are ideal for high-end gamers and creators who require superior visual fidelity and performance in applications like 3D rendering.
- AMD cards deliver excellent value, offering strong rasterisation performance at a competitive price, and are a perfect fit for mainstream gamers. Their FSR technology provides a significant performance boost.
- Intel’s Arc series targets the mid-range market, providing great value and a strong focus on media capabilities with AV1 encoding. These cards are a solid choice for budget-conscious gamers and streamers who need advanced media features.
